Fyre Festival Money Pit

Billy McFarland shares a story about the chaotic financial management of Fyre Festival and his daily struggle to raise money.

"We had a budget for $10 million for the festival. I didn't have $10 million, but I thought I could reasonably raise it just off the brand we were building. We ended up spending way more than that.

It got to the point where I would go to sleep with no money in the bank, wake up and know that day I had to raise a certain dollar amount just to survive. Some days it was $50,000, some days it was $4 million. I'd wake up at 9 AM and know I had until 2 PM to get X dollars in the bank to rewire it out before the day ended.

We ended up raising 26 or 27 million, but we were making money from other sources too - selling tickets, getting sponsors, Magnesis was making money, I was doing consulting jobs. Over that 6-month period, we probably spent closer to $40 million. Meanwhile, we sold just under 6,000 tickets, with median ticket prices around $1,200-1,500, generating only about $10 million in sales."
